Abstract: Three new compounds, including two diterpenoids, nemoralisins H and I(1 and 2), and a limonoid, 2-methoxy khayseneganin E(3), along with four known constituents(4-7), were isolated from the leaves and twigs of Swietenia mahagoni. Their chemical structures were elucidated by means of spectroscopic analysis. The cytotoxities of these isolated constituents were assayed.

Key words: Meliaceae, Swietenia mahagoni, Diterpenoids, Limonoids
